Parallel Translations

  • WEB World English Bible

    He said to them, “Collect no more than that which is appointed to you.”

  • TYNDALE Tyndale New Testament (1534)

    And he sayde vnto the: requyre no more then that which ys appoynted vnto you.

  • GNV Geneva Bible (1599)

    And hee saide vnto them, Require no more then that which is appointed vnto you.
